$ORCL The earnings report is coming soon; what really matters is whether OCI can continue to hold up.
The market expects OCI growth to reach around 115%. If that materializes, AI computing demand is still there, and Oracle’s AI cloud story is not over yet.
But the biggest problem now is also Capex. AI data centers keep requiring massive spending; rapid revenue growth is one thing, but whether the money can ultimately be earned back is another.
So for this earnings report, I’m personally more focused on OCI growth and the subsequent capital expenditure guidance.
